Here’s what you can expect when you take the first step with us.

Initial Consultation

It all starts with a meeting with a Boston IVF reproductive endocrinologist who is an expert in fertility care for LGBTQ+ families. They will answer any and all questions you have about the family-building process.

Fertility Assessment

A fertility assessment comes next for either or both partners who are contributing eggs or carrying the baby. This involves a health history, bloodwork, and some diagnostic imaging of the reproductive organs.

Treatment and Donor Selection

Based on the fertility assessment and wishes of both partners, you’ll work with your clinical team on a treatment plan. The partners will select a sperm donor by working with one of our accredited third-party partners.

Donor Sperm

Family building with two moms requires a sperm contribution from a donor. Sperm can come from a known donor or through a sperm bank. One factor to consider is whether you may want more children later on with the same genetic father.

IUI

In IUI, we place a flexible catheter through the cervix and introduce sperm directly into the uterus around the time of ovulation, which can rely on your natural cycle or use medications to induce ovulation. If egg and sperm meet up, you could become pregnant.

IVF

An IVF cycle involves controlled ovarian stimulation with injectable medication, egg retrieval, fertilization with donor sperm and transfer of an embryo. In classic IVF for female couples, one of the two moms both provides the egg and carries the pregnancy.

Partner Assisted Reproduction (PAR)

In same-sex female couples, Partner Assisted Reproduction (PAR) enables both partners to participate in conception and pregnancy. One partner donates the egg, fertilized with donor sperm in the lab, while the other partner carries the pregnancy after embryo transfer to her uterus.
